背景情况:
- 精确地定位发性区域 (EZ) 对于成功的手术至关重要.
- 目前使用脑电图 (EEG) 的方法通常会产生低于最佳的EZ局部化,这是由于可变的脑间和脑间活动模式.
- 识别可概括的神经信号特征可以提高EZ定位精度.
研究的目的:
- 为了确定神经信号是否反映了患者的性性,从间接到间接的时间概括到患者的时间.
- 为了调查型模式是否在不同患者中泛化.
- 识别特定的信号特征,这些特征可用于改进EZ本地化.
主要方法:
- 利用了55名患者的内EEG数据集.
- 从静态EEG (SEEG) 和电皮图学 (ECoG) 信号中提取了34个特征,这些特征是在间接和间接阶段.
- 采用决策树分类器来评估跨时间窗口和患者的概括性.
主要成果:
- 强有力的证据表明,在患者之间,从间歇到间歇期的发性信号具有普遍性.
- 在跨时间窗口的患者中观察到一致的发性模式.
- 信号特征,特别是复杂性和高频网络属性,显示出跨患者的概括性,特别是在ictal阶段.
结论:
- 发性神经活动模式在时间和患者之间表现出显著的概括性.
- 信号复杂性和网络特征是跨患者概括的关键因素.
- 这些发现对开发自动化EZ定位工具有影响,以帮助手术规划.
